Restorative Medicine Centers: What to Imagine

Visiting a modern regenerative medicine center can feel different, so familiarizing yourself with the process is key. Generally, your first meeting will involve a complete medical history and a conversation of your specific goals. Expect advanced evaluation methods, perhaps including imaging or sample testing. The procedure itself may utilize growth factors – sourced from your own cells or a thoroughly vetted donor – and will be administered by trained specialists. Recovery periods will vary based on the condition being managed, so honest conversation with your physician is vital.

A Outlook of Therapy: Examining Regenerative Therapies

The area of healthcare is undergoing a significant transformation, and regenerative therapies stand at the forefront. Such approaches hold the potential to regenerate diseased tissue and even alleviate previously intractable conditions. Current investigation is directed on utilizing derived stem cells to target a range of ailments, including heart disease, glucose intolerance, spinal cord injuries, and age-related illnesses like dementia and Parkinson's. Obstacles remain, including perfecting cell differentiation, confirming well-being, and increasing availability. Notwithstanding the ongoing effort, the future for stem cell therapies appears bright, possibly signaling a breakthrough in contemporary health treatment.

Restorative Medicine: Restoring Your System Inside

Regenerative treatment represents a revolutionary method to healthcare, shifting the attention from simply managing symptoms to actually rebuilding damaged tissue. This developing field seeks to harness the body’s natural ability to recover itself, utilizing sophisticated techniques like therapeutic cell implantation, scaffolds, and growth factors. Imagine receiving the chance to rebuild worn cartilage after an injury, or to restore heart tissue after a myocardial infarction.
